22 Years of Allu Arjun: Allu Arjun was often referred to as “Stylish Star” or “Icon star” of Indian cinema, and has successfully completed 22 years in his film journey. From making his debut with Gangothri in 2003 to becoming Pan Indian star in 2025 with Pushpa 2: The Rule is nothing short of astonishing. Allu Arjun’s career of 22 years was nothing short of perfectly blended with huge love from fans, backlash for his looks in his early career and blockbuster hits and controversies.
Allu Arjun made his acting debut with Gangotri back in 2003. This film was directed by K. Raghavendra Rao, marking his debut as a lead actor in Telugu Cinema. But he faced a lot of backlash for his looks in the film. However Allu Arjun received stardom with his next film With Sukumar’s Arya released in 2004. This movie got him massive fan following because of his energetic dance moves and unique style. Ever since Allu Arjun became a household name, and never looked back.
Allu Arjun has delivered numerous blockbusters over the years. Films like Arya, Bunny, and Sarrainodu solidified his position as a leading actor. His recent hits, Ala Vaikunthapurramuloo and Pushpa: The Rise, broke box office records, with the latter grossing over ₹350 crore worldwide. The sequel, Pushpa: The Rule, further cemented his status as a pan-Indian star, making him one of the most bankable actors in the industry.
Though Allu Arjun is popular around the world, Allu Arjun has his share of controversies. In 2016, he was badly trolled for his comment “Cheppanu Brother” from a public event left Pawan Kalyan fans furious. Also, he faced a lot of backlash for portraying a Brahmin character in Duvvada Jagannadham, released in 2017. Despite the film being a super hit at the box office, certain brahmin communities accused him of disrespecting their traditions. The most recent controversy includes the Sangeetha Theatre stampede incident, which took place during the Pushpa 2 premier show. This marks the biggest controversy in Allu Arjun’s career.
As of 2025, Allu Arjun’s estimated net worth is ₹380 crore. He charges between ₹60 crore and ₹125 crore per film, making him one of the highest-paid actors in India. In addition to his film earnings, he endorses several high-profile brands and has investments in various business ventures. His luxurious lifestyle includes a ₹38 crore mansion in Hyderabad and a collection of premium cars like the Rolls-Royce Spectre and Ferrari Portofino.
